묻고답하기
page_full_width" class="col-xs-12" |cond="$__Context->page_full_width">
VB.NET에서 XE 사이트에 글쓰기인데 잘 안되네요..
2015.01.27 19:37
Private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
winhttp.Open("POST", "http://사이트 주소/index.php?mid=log&act=dispBoardWrite") '회원로그인폼주소를 입력.
WinHttp.SetRequestHeader("Content-Type", "application/x-www-form-urlencoded")
WinHttp.Send("title =" & Textbox2.Text) ' 제목칸 입력
WinHttp.Send("xe_content editable =" & TextBox1.Text) ' 내용칸 입력
WinHttp.Send("registration") ' 등록
winhttp.WaitForResponse()
End Sub
이렇게 코드를 작성했습니다.
근데 실행은 되는데 버튼을 누르면 글 등록이 전혀 안되네요...
뭐가 문제인지 모르겠습니다..
등록 버튼 코드가 잘못된건지...
아시는 분 좀 도와주시면 정말 감사하겠습니다..
댓글 11
-
kdp
2015.01.27 19:38
-
마키치노
2015.01.27 19:47
xmlhttprequest를 이용하면 되는건가요?
-
kdp
2015.01.27 19:41
그리고 send쪽은
"첫줄" & _
"두번째줄"
이렇게 하셔야 합니다
-
마키치노
2015.01.27 19:44
winhttp.Open("POST", "http://bbu9473.dothome.co.kr/index.php?mid=log&act=dispBoardWrite") 'WinHttp.SetRequestHeader("Content-Type", "application/x-www-form-urlencoded")WinHttp.Send("title =" & Label1.Text & _ "xe_content editable =" & TextBox1.Text & _ "registration")winhttp.WaitForResponse()이렇게 수정하면 될까요? -
kdp
2015.01.27 19:52
잘못적었네요 http://cafe.naver.com/gogoomas/293516
-
마키치노
2015.01.27 19:52
감사합니다.
-
마키치노
2015.01.27 20:52
저기 질문 하나만더...
이건 뭐에 쓰이는 건가요?
-
kdp
2015.01.27 21:03
그냥 아무것도 아닙니다.
-
마키치노
2015.01.27 21:17
아하...그렇..군요!
똑같이 넣긴 했는데요
그럼 저 부분 지워도 되는건가요?
-
kdp
2015.01.27 21:18
지워도 되고 안지워도 됩니다.
-
마키치노
2015.01.27 21:22
아하 감사합니다.
여튼 덕분에 성공했습니다.
정말 감사합니다. :D
xml형식으로 post하셔야합니다...